Aesthetic Inspection Techniques



Employing systematic visual inspection methods is vital for evaluating the high quality and stability of bonded joints in tanks. This method serves as the first line of defense in determining prospective flaws such as fractures, undercuts, and inadequate infiltration. The examiner needs to come close to the job with an eager eye, making use of ideal devices like amplifying glasses, flashlights, and mirrors to improve visibility.


During the examination procedure, the assessor needs to review the weld account, guaranteeing it follows specified requirements and guidelines (Tank Welding Inspection). This includes checking out the grain width, height, and blend with the base product. Examiners should likewise pay close interest to the surrounding locations for indicators of thermal distortion or contamination that might influence the weld's efficiency


Documentation of searchings for is crucial; assessors must record any kind of abnormalities, classifying them by seriousness for further analysis. This methodical approach not just aids in prompt problem identification however likewise adds to long-lasting top quality assurance by making sure conformity with market criteria. Non-Destructive Checking Methods



Non-destructive screening (NDT) techniques are often employed in storage tank welding inspections to examine the integrity of welded joints without jeopardizing their architectural integrity. These methods are vital for determining problems such as splits, voids, and incorporations that could result in tragic failures if left unnoticed.


Usual NDT approaches include ultrasonic screening (UT), which utilizes high-frequency sound waves to discover inner flaws; radiographic testing (RT), using X-rays or gamma rays to imagine weld frameworks; and magnetic fragment testing (MT), which exposes surface area and near-surface discontinuities in ferromagnetic materials (Tank Welding Inspection). Fluid penetrant screening (PT) is also commonly made use of, efficient in finding surface-breaking issues by using a fluorescent or shade contrast color


Each NDT approach has its details applications and benefits, making it essential for examiners to pick the suitable method based upon the product and the kind of weld being reviewed. The assimilation of these NDT approaches right into the examination process boosts the overall quality assurance framework, making sure that welded storage tanks satisfy security and efficiency criteria. Inevitably, NDT plays a crucial duty in maintaining the integrity and longevity of storage tank structures in different industrial applications.

Paperwork and Coverage



Making sure complete documentation and reporting throughout container welding inspections is crucial for keeping compliance with industry criteria and promoting effective communication amongst stakeholders. Correct paperwork acts as an extensive record of examination tasks, findings, and any type of restorative activities taken throughout the welding procedure. This info is necessary not just for quality guarantee however likewise for audits and governing reviews.




A well-structured evaluation report need to include details such as the day of examination, names of assessors, welding treatments utilized, materials made use of, and any variances from developed standards. In addition, photographs and layouts can boost the clarity of the report, giving aesthetic context to the searchings for. It is also important to record any type of non-conformities along with their resolution, ensuring that all stakeholders are notified of potential threats and you could try this out the steps taken to alleviate them.


Additionally, preserving a central database for all inspection records enables very easy retrieval and testimonial, fostering a society of transparency and liability.
